1. A push button padlock comprising:

  • a housing, a shackle mounted to said housing and movable between an open position in which said padlock in unlocked and a closed position in which said padlock is locked, a shackle detachment movable between a first position in which said shackle detachment engages an end of said shackle to prevent said shackle from moving from its closed position to its open position and a second position in which said shackle detachment is disengaged from said shackle to allow said shackle to move between said open and closed positions;

    a push button slide plate for operatively connected to said shackle detachment;

    a plurality of push buttons mounted to said housing for said push button slide plate, said push buttons being movable between a raised position and a pressed position;

    at least one of said push buttons being constructed as releasing push button, the remainder of said push buttons being constructed as blocking push buttons;

    said at least one releasing push button engaging said slide plate when said at least one releasing push button is in said raised position to prevent movement of said slide plate and hence prevent movement of said shackle detachment from said first position to said second position and being disengaged from said slide plate when in said pressed position to allow movement of said slide plate, and hence to permit movement of said shackle detachment from said first position to said second position;

    said blocking push buttons being out of engagement said slide plate when said blocking push button is in said raised position to permit movement of said slide plate and hence permit movement of said shackle detachment from said first position to said second position and being engaged with said slide plate when in said pressed position to prevent movement of said slide plate, and hence to prevent movement of said shackle detachment from said first position to said second position;

    whereby, said shackle detachment can be moved from said first position to said second position only when said at least one releasing push button is in said pressed position and all said blocking push buttons are in said raised position. said push buttons having independently mounted spring caps to assist in camouflaging the at least one releasing push button and the blocking push buttons from each other;
